Output 8527aaf61eb9114ebb288286dfa27cc286a745bfb05e258b905909925078f217:1

value
399273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afcdc839fab05ed6f8be8a8b89681ee51537d69b OP_EQUALVERIFY OP_CHECKSIG
address
1H2ZmZhJ91ef36xqxvhVMSeCZihHazqMQ6
transaction
8527aaf61eb9114ebb288286dfa27cc286a745bfb05e258b905909925078f217
confirmations
426212
spent
true